Job description

JOB REQUIREMENTS

Position Summary: Serves as the primary contact of our organization to serve member requests related to their daily financial needs. The Member Service Representative will perform a wide variety of duties related to all phases of products, services and policies as embodied by Westby Co-op Credit Union. These are done in accordance with Westby Co-op Credit Union procedures.

PRINCIPA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

Perform Member Service Representative duties, including but not limited to, maintaining comments and notes on accounts, handling currency, basic deposits, withdrawals and payments, issuance of negotiable instruments and cash advances. Adheres to all balancing, cash, check-cashing and related policies, or procedures. Executes check negotiation procedures to ensure regular, foreign and onus checks are processed for payment. Performs inquiries and generates statements for members to assist with financial information questions. Complies with Bank Secrecy Act legislation and requirements. Process requests for members who order checks. Demonstrates a helpful, polite, friendly attitude along with providing exceptional member service. Educates members on products, services, fees, and policies regarding their financial information. Always maintains the integrity of our confidentiality policy including maintaining a neat work area so confidential information is not compromised. Works with others in their department to maintain, organize and revise member financial information. Properly enter information into the computer program(s) regarding transactions, holds, statements, order requests and other related transactions. Maintain an expansive, up-to-date knowledge of products, services, fees, and regulations to assist members and co-workers accurately and efficiently. Scan account information into computer system. Prepare gift cards for members who purchase them. Redeem savings bonds. Complete and maintenance stop payment requests from members. Prepare counter checks, casher checks and corporate checks. Assist members with access to their safe deposit box. Assist with the initial request for members who want to complete a wire transaction. Help a member with fraud situations, including but not limited to, debit cards, credit cards, ACH, and checks. Maintenance address and name changes on the various software programs. Maintenance of ATM machine in designated office. Add additional share accounts to existing membership accounts.

MOBILE BRANCH RESPONSIBILITIES

Provides coverage as needed. Occasional weekday, evening and Saturday rotations may be scheduled in advance for special community events.

ADDITIONAL P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S

Ability to maneuver, lift and carry hose lines for emptying black tank. Ability to bend, reach, lift and apply 5-10 pounds of pressure when washing the vehicle. Daily stair climbing (3-5 stairs).

WORK RELATIONSHIPS AND SCOPE

Reports directly to the Branch Manager. Will have regular contact with members and employees of the Member Service Department.

OTHER EXPERIENCE AND QUALIFICATIONS

Education/Experience: Previous financial and cash handling experience desired. Financial post-secondary education preferred.

Skills and Abilities: Ability to perform basic mathematical calculations accurately, such as adding, subtracting, multiplying and dividing. Ability to manage personal workflow, process transactions and meet deadlines by being organized, detailed and task oriented. Ability to work with a wide range of personalities in a courteous, effective, and efficient manner. Knowledge and ability to apply current financial service industry standards, laws, and regulations. Ability to present ideas, report facts and other information clearly and concisely.

Proficient knowledge of the Microsoft Suite (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int). Proficient operation of a variety of general office equipment such as a computer, software applic tions, typewriter, calculator, telephone, copy machine, fax machine and other similar devices or programs related to the position.
